[jira] [Updated] (SPARK-29962) Avoid changing merge join to
broadcast join if one side is non-shuffle and the other side can be
broadcast
[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-29962?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:all-tabpanel ]
Yuming Wang updated SPARK-29962:
--------------------------------
Description:
It seem SortMergeJoin faster than BroadcastJoin if one side is non-shuffle and the other side can be broadcast:
